About the role

POSITION SUMMARY:

This is an exciting opportunity to lead the Biostatistics efforts supporting Natera’s product portfolio of cutting-edge molecular diagnostic tests. As Lead Biostatistician, you will leverage your medical device/assay development background along with your experience in applied statistics to oversee the design, analysis, and reporting of validation experiments to support our oncology portfolio. The ideal candidate will possess strong communication skills and a deep understanding of biostatistics in analytical validation.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Study Design and Analysis: Oversee the design, statistical analysis, and interpretation of analytical validation studies in support of oncology product development.

  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with bench scientists, regulatory, and product development teams to integrate statistical expertise into project planning and execution. Identify risks, communicate concerns, and champion solutions to interdisciplinary teams.

  • Documentation and Reporting: Prepare high-quality protocols and reports for cross-functional collaborators and stakeholders.

  • Regulatory Compliance: Ensure statistical methodologies and analyses meet the standards set by regulatory agencies such as CAP/CLIA, NYS, and the FDA.

  • Innovation and Improvement: Provide leadership on the application of both common and cutting-edge statistical methods for studies of varying complexity. Directly influence and maintain departmental standards.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Ph.D. or Master's degree in Biostatistics, Statistics, or a related field.

  • Minimum 6 years of relevant industry experience, with a focus on analytical validation in diagnostics, biotechnology, or related industries.

  • Minimum of 3 years practical experience with R statistical analysis software

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ES:

  • Expert working knowledge of statistical methodology in diagnostic medicine, including an understanding of CLSI and FDA guidelines

  • Demonstrated ability and enthusiasm for working on cross-functional teams with members of diverse technical backgrounds

  • Strong track record of producing high quality written documentation for multiple audiences·   

  • Exceptional problem-solving skills and attention to detail

  • Aptitude for technical leadership. Proven record of leading a team a plus

  • Prior experience with NGS, genetics, and/or oncology testing a plus.

Natera™ is a global leader in cell-free DNA (cfDNA) testing, dedicated to oncology, women’s health, and organ health. Our aim is to make personalized genetic testing and diagnostics part of the standard of care to protect health and enable earlier and more targeted interventions that lead to longer, healthier lives.
